SONS LOSE TO QUEEN OF THE SOUTH

Saturday 10th March 2018

DUMBARTON fought hard but went down to a 1-0 defeat at the hands of Queen of the South at the YOUR Radio 103FM Stadium this afternoon.

In a robust first half both sides negotiated a difficult playing surface with direct, gritty, attacking football.

There were several chances for both teams, with the respective defences and keepers kept busy and defenders reacting well.

At half time it was still even and goalless. Just after the break, however, Queen of the South broke the deadlock and took the lead.

On 47 minutes a powerful free-kick from Queens’ Thomas found its way into the bottom corner of the next.

The tussle continued, but on 64 minutes Sons has a golden chance to equalise when Danny Handling’s free-kick on the edge of the area was punched away from the wall — only for Kevin Nisbet to smash the resulting penalty way over the bar and upright on the left hand side.

The game continued to move end to end after that defining moment, but neither side was able to add to the score sheet, in spite of another strong but unheeded Sons penalty shout near the end.

The defeat leaves Dumbarton firmly planted in ninth place ahead of the visit of foot-of-the-table Brechin City to the Rock on Tuesday night, 13th March.
